Key China Copper Gauge Rallies to $100 After Tax Crackdown

The News

A key gauge of China's copper market has risen to its highest level in over a year, driven by a tax shake-up that created a scrap shortage and boosted demand for imports. The policy change in the world's largest copper market has tightened scrap supply, increasing reliance on imported material. This development underscores the impact of regulatory shifts on commodity prices and trade flows.
